Christian Hospitality and Pastoral Practices in a Multifaith Society project 

Christian leaders in the United States and Canada are increasingly called upon to exercise their pastoral practices in contexts that require understanding of faith traditions other than their own. Through generous support by the Henry Luce Foundation, the Christian Hospitality and Pastoral Practices in a Multifaith Society (CHAPP) project sought to help theological schools prepare their graduates to serve faithfully and effectively in multifaith contexts. Eighteen grants were awarded to help schools explore ways to integrate multifaith elements into their curricula during the 2011–12 academic year.
